Job Description

Come join our team as a Plumber I! 

The position of Plumber I is critical to learning the plumbing trade and steadily improving both quality and speed over time.

RESPONSIBILITIES  

  • Studiously learn the necessary aspects of drain, waste, vent (DWV), water systems, and other aspects including but not limited to setting of tubs and installation of plumbing fittings and fixtures.
  • Accurately build and install complete plumbing systems showcasing a clear understanding of all types of plumbing fittings.
  • Ensure adherence to safety and quality of work standards.
  • Deliberately manage materials needed for various projects.
  • Steadily accumulate knowledge of basic tools required for plumbing work (soldering, cutting, and notching) and be able to put that knowledge into use within thirty (30) days.
  • Precisely and regularly maintain a clean and organized jobsite.
  • Thoughtfully follow directions and processes given by site leadership.
  • Enthusiastically motivated to learn the plumbing trade.
  • Maintain compliance with state trade licensing programs.
  • Build knowledge of Plumbing Code.
  • Maintain excellent attendance and punctuality to adhere to work schedule.

  QUALIFICATIONS  

  • Motivated work ethic.
  • Clear verbal communication skills.
  • Basic mathematical ability including add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division.
  • Ability to read, write, and interpret reports and documents such as safety rules, operating instructions, procedure manual, and blueprints / CAD drawings.
  • Critical thinking skills and ability to problem solve independently.
  • A high school diploma or GED is required.
  • Obtain apprentice licensing in appropriate states.
  • Exposed to outdoor weather conditions including rain, humidity, snow, wind, cold, and heat.
  • The environment may include very loud noises, working near mechanical and moving parts, working at various heights, and small, awkward, confining workspaces.
  • There is the possibility of inhalation of fumes and airborne particles as well as the risk of electrical shock and vibrations.
  • Must be able to do the following activities for most of the workday: stand, walk, use hands or fingers, handle or feel, reach with hands and arms,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l, see, talk, and hear.
  • Must be able to climb or balance regularly.
  • Near constant lifting or carrying of items of various weights, typically up to 10 pounds most of the day. Capable of lifting at least 50 pounds on occasion.
  • Manual dexterity sufficient to reach/handle items, work with the fingers, and perceive attributes of objects and materials.
  • Wear job site-specific personal protective equipment and be able to lift at least 50 pounds.
  • Possible travel to out of town/out of state projects

SCHEDULE: Monday to Friday  

LOCATION: On-site  

SALARY/HOURLY RATE: $18-$26 Hourly Non Exempt
